Section 2-180. Funding. <br /> The geothermal relocation and community benefits program shall be <br /> funded by proceeds from the following sources: <br /> [(a}] ~ Geothermal royalties received from the department of land and natural <br /> resources. <br /> [(kj] ~ Proceeds from the sale of properties purchased under this program. <br /> [Ecj] ~ Rental fees from any of the properties purchased under this program. <br /> Section 2-181. Expenditures from fund. <br /> ~ The proceeds from the fund shall be used for the necessary <br /> expenses in administering and carrying out the purposes of the geothermal <br /> relocation and community benefits program. A minimum balance of $200,000 <br /> shall be maintained in the fund for expenditures relatine to ¢eothermal relocation. <br /> Expenditures relating to the geothermal relocation and community benefits <br /> program include, but are not limited to: <br /> ~ The costs of any necessary appraisals required under this program; <br /> ~ The payment of necessary fees and expenses; <br /> ~ The costs for the purchase of an affected dwelling and property in <br /> accordance with this chapter, if necessary; [aud] <br /> ~ The costs necessary to dispose of or rent affected dwelling and <br /> property[-] ;and <br /> Expenditures for public purooses includine road improvement water <br /> infrastructure land acquisition, parks and recreational facility needs, <br /> civil defense, and mass transit improvements. <br /> ~A) Funds shall be expended in Lower Puna. which is defined as <br /> extendin¢ from Hawaiian Paradise Park subdivision to Kalanana and <br /> including Orchidland Estates, Ainaloa, Hawaiian Beaches, Hawaiian <br /> Shores, Kapoho, Pahoa, Nanawale, Leilani Estates, and other <br /> communities proximate to Pahoa. <br /> (B) Expenditures under this subsection shall be made in accordance <br /> with appropriations adopted by the Hawaii County Council after <br /> receiving recommendations from the Planning Director. <br /> Section 2-182. Promulgation authority. <br /> The planning director is authorized to promulgate rules and regulations for <br /> implementation of the relocation program." <br /> SECTION 2. Severability.
